The 1976 film “Taxi Driver” will finally get an individual 4K UHD Blu-ray SteelBook release on June 25th via Sony Pictures Home Entertainment. The film, directed by Martin Scorsese, starred Robert De Niro, Jodie Foster, Albert Brooks, Harvey Keitel, Leonard Harris, Peter Boyle, and Cybill Shepard. The release will come as a “combo pack” with its Blu-ray Disc counterpart included, along with a digital copy of the film. The tech specs for the release include a 2160p video presentation in the 1.85:1 aspect ratio with Dolby Vision and HDR10 forms of high dynamic range and DTS-HD Master Audio 5.1 and Mono lossless sound mixes. 4K UHD Blu-ray Disc extras:

  • Making “Taxi Driver” Documentary
  • Storyboard to Film Comparisons with Martin Scorsese Introduction
  • Photo Galleries
  • 20th Anniversary Re-Release Trailer

Blu-ray Disc extras:

  • 40-Minute “Taxi Driver” Q&A featuring Martin Scorsese, Robert De Niro, Jodie Foster and Many More. Recorded Live at the Beacon Theater in New York City at the 2016 Tribeca Film Festival
  • Commentary with Director Martin Scorsese and Writer Paul Schrader Recorded by The Criterion Collection
  • Commentaries with Writer Paul Schrader and by Professor Robert Kolker
  • Martin Scorsese on “Taxi Driver”
  • Producing “Taxi Driver”
  • God’s Lonely Man
  • “Taxi Driver” Stories
  • Travis’ New York
  • Travis’ New York Locations
  • Influence ad Appreciation: A Martin Scorsese Tribute
  • Theatrical Trailer
